Owning your dream home shouldn't be impossible, even if you've faced some credit challenges in the past. Private home loans offer an option for borrowers with less-than-perfect credit, providing a path to real estate investment. These loans are provided by private lenders rather than traditional banks, which means they often have relaxed lending criteria.

Thinking about a private home loan, read more it's important to carefully research different lenders and compare their terms and conditions. Pay attention to the interest rates, fees, and repayment schedule. Be sure to understand all the details of the loan agreement before you sign.

A good credit score can help improve your chances of approval for a private home loan, but it's not always a dealbreaker. Lenders may consider variables like your income, debt-to-income ratio, and work history when making a decision.

Improving your credit score before you apply for a loan can may decrease the interest rates you qualify for. This involves paying bills punctually consistently, keeping your credit utilization low, and staying away from opening new credit accounts unnecessarily.

Remember, a private home loan can be a viable solution for borrowers with bad credit, but it's important to do your research, grasp the terms and conditions, and work diligently to improve your credit score.

Advantages of Choosing a Private Home Loan

Securing a loan for your dream home can be a daunting challenge. Traditional lenders often have rigid guidelines, which can make it difficult to qualify, especially if you have a unique fiscal situation. This is where private home loans offer a flexible alternative. These loans are typically provided by individuals or companies outside of the conventional lending industry. Private lenders often have less strict requirements and are more willing to assess your individual circumstances. This can mean a smoother validation process and faster access to the funds you need to make your homeownership dreams a reality.

Alternative Funding Solutions : Private Home Loans for Construction

For individuals venturing into the complex world of luxury construction, securing funding can often present a significant challenge. Traditional mortgage lenders may hesitate to finance projects that are still in their developmental stages. This is where private home loans steps in, providing a crucial alternative for homeowners seeking to realize their construction dreams. These private loans are typically offered by investment firms who specialize in construction finance. They often have relaxed underwriting criteria and quicker turnaround times, making them a viable option for developers needing construction financing outside the conventional banking system.

  • Benefits of Private Home Loans for Construction Include: :
  • Quicker Funding Processes : Private lenders often have simplified processes, leading to prompt funding decisions and quicker access to capital.
  • Customized Loan Terms: : Private lenders are more willing to consider applications from those seeking financing outside conventional lending norms.
  • Higher Loan Amounts Available: : Private loans may offer more substantial funding compared to traditional mortgage lenders, allowing for the development of more extensive projects.
